The Challenges of Podiatry Billing
Podiatry billing can be complex, with its own set of codes, modifiers, and regulations. Common challenges include:
Choosing codes that do not reflect the procedure done can cause an insurance company to deny the claim. Incorrect coding can lead to lost revenue. Alongside that, frequent denials can trigger audits from the payers. Hence, understanding podiatry coding is essential for the right medical coding.
The specificity of podiatry services often necessitates proof of medical necessity, and requests for such information from insurance payers are always time-sensitive. A large percentage of podiatry claims are underpaid due to providers simply not submitting the charts on time.
Claim denials are unavoidable in podiatry medical billing; reducing revenue loss requires efficient denial management. Thus, long reimbursement cycles and lost income opportunities can arise from inadequate follow-up on rejected claims and an unorganized appeals process.

Optimizing Your Podiatry Revenue Cycle Management
Effective podiatry revenue cycle management (RCM) is essential for a healthy bottom line. Here are some key strategies:
-
Comprehensive Documentation:
Accurate and detailed documentation supports accurate coding and billing. -
Regular Audits:
Periodic audits identify potential billing errors and areas for improvement. -
Staff Training:
Ongoing training ensures the billing staff is knowledgeable and up-to-date. It is an essential but resource-consuming step. -
Technology Solutions:
Utilizing specialized billing software can streamline processes and improve accuracy. This can save a lot of time and resources. -

- Why is podiatry medical billing complex?
-
Podiatry medical billing involves specialized codes, modifiers, and regulations unique to foot and ankle care. Additionally, many insurance providers require proof of medical necessity for certain procedures, making claim submissions more time-sensitive and prone to denials if not handled correctly.
- How can podiatry practices reduce claim denials and revenue loss?
-
Podiatry practices can reduce claim denials by ensuring accurate medical coding, timely documentation submission, and proactive claim scrubbing. Implementing an organized denial management system and appealing rejected claims efficiently also help minimize revenue loss.
